Recently, Golden Entertainment Inc., a flagship operator of slot routes, casinos and taverns based in Las Vegas, revealed that it has finalized the formerly mentioned sale of Rocky Gap Casino Resort in Maryland for a total cash consideration of roughly $260 million, subject to customary equity capital adjustments.

Purchase agreements:

Under the terms of the agreements, Century Casinos, Inc. of Colorado purchased the Rocky Gap business for roughly $56.1 million, subject to customary working capital adjustments, and New York-based VICI Properties Inc. purchased a stake in the buildings and land connected with Rocky Gap for roughly $203.9 million. Additionally, $175 million of the revenue from the sale will be used to repay outstanding term loans.

During the transaction process, Macquarie Capital took the role of exclusive financial advisor, and Latham & Watkins and Duane Morris were Golden’s legal advisors.

Main reasons for the purchases:

The purchase by Century Casinos was because the company will now have the possibility to further extend Rocky Gap to attract more customers from neighboring markets and enter the Maryland casino market. On a related note, Century said: “We have amended our triple-net master-lease agreement with VICI to add the Rocky Gap property. The amendment includes an increase in initial annualized rent of about $15.5 million.” In addition, Century funded the purchase with cash from its balance sheet and $30 million loaned from a revolving credit deal with Goldman Sachs. In this regard, in a statement, Erwin Haitzmann and Peter Hoetzinger, co-CEOs of Century Casinos, said: “Rocky Gap is a great addition to our portfolio for expanding into Maryland.”

Rocky Gap is a good investment because it is located in Flintstone at Rocky Gap State Park, which lures over half a million visitors annually. It covers 270 acres and involves a 196-room hotel, meeting spaces, an event center, an 18-hole golf course and a spa designed by Jack Nicklaus. Also, the casino is 25,000 square feet with 16 table games and 630 slot machines. What’s more, Rocky Gap recently underwent a re-modelling process, worth $10 million, of the hotel, restaurants, slot machines and sports lounge.

State of the companies after the transaction:

As for Century and Golden Entertainment, the former now has 19 casinos across the world with over 7,500 gaming machines and 268 table games, while the latter company now has eight casinos located in southern Nevada and 65 gaming taverns in Nevada. Also, through its distributed gaming businesses in Montana and Nevada, the company also operates video game devices in almost 1,000 locations.
